Toluwaloju Duro-Bello, FCA, MSc, BSc.

Non Executive Director

Mr. Toluwaloju Duro-Bello is a Chartered Accountant with extensive expertise in corporate governance, financial advisory, auditing, and taxation. Renowned for his meticulous attention to detail, analytical problem-solving skills, and dedication to organizational excellence, he has built a distinguished career in the financial sector.

As Co-Founder and Chief Operating Officer at Koboaccountant Africa, Toluwaloju has successfully enhanced operational efficiency and delivered impactful financial solutions. His extensive experience includes advising a diverse range of organizations, from Africa’s largest conglomerates to non-profits, faith-based organizations, small and medium enterprises, and subnational entities.

A graduate of the University of Dundee in the United Kingdom, where he earned a Master’s degree in Accounting and Finance, Toluwaloju is deeply committed to fostering innovation and upholding ethical governance practices.

In his role as a Non-Executive Director at Floret Center for Genomics and Bioinformatics Research, Toluwaloju brings a wealth of expertise in governance, financial oversight, and strategic leadership. His passion for advancing impactful research and education aligns with Floret’s mission to drive groundbreaking discoveries in genomics and bioinformatics.
